Subject: | Push Rod Tube Stub Hoses |
Gentlemen,
what kind of hose are you using
to replace the push rod tube
connection at the crankcase
on a Huosai or M14P?
The outside diameter of the push
rod tube is roughly 17.8mm and on
the crankcase it is around 18.9mm.
